Operation “Damask”: SIPA Arrested 16 Individuals Linked to Terrorism

Police officials of the State Investigation and Protection Agency (SIPA) initiated an operation code-named “Damask” in a wide territory of Bosnia and Herzegovina. Arrests, searches and terrain inspections are underway at several locations in Sarajevo, Kiseljak, Zenica, Maglaj (Ošve and Gornja Bočina), Srebrenik (Gornja Maoča), Zvornik, Tuzla, Kalesija, Banovići, Bužim and Teslić, with the aim of detecting and seizing items that can be used as evidence in further proceedings. Currently, 17 locations are being searched and 16 individuals are placed under control.

These individuals are suspected of committing criminal offences of financing terrorist activities, public incitement to terrorist activities, recruitment for terrorist activities, organising a terrorist group, all in conjunction with the criminal offence of terrorism. They are linked to financing, organising and recruiting BH nationals for departure to Syria and Iraq, as well as taking part in armed conflicts in Syria and Iraq, while fighting for radical terrorist groups and organisations.

The activities are being carried out upon orders by the court BH and Prosecutor’s Office BH, with more than 200 police officials involved. The operation is being carried out in cooperation with members of the Intelligence Security Agency BH, Republic of Srpska Ministry of Interior, Brčko District Police, Zenica-Doboj Canton Ministry of Interior, Tuzla Canton Ministry of Interior, Una-Sana Canton Ministry of Interior and Sarajevo Canton Ministry of Interior.
